C/C++培训
达内IT学院
400-996-5531
首先我不落俗套的讲讲为什么要学c语言:
第一:C语言是一门基础语言,是学习其他语言的基础。据说java和。Net的底层都是用C语言来编写的,windows和linux内核也是C语言来编写的。
第二:C语言功能强大。因为C语言拥有指针这一强大的工具,所以有着更高的权限可以让我们使用更多的功能,像java就不能操作其他程序,不能用于写外挂,写一些黑客工具什么的。
接下来进入正题讲一讲学C语言的基本要求:
学习C语言,不需要多少英语。你只需要记得32个关键字。一天10个,也就3天学完。
auto局部变量(自动储存)
break无条件退出程序最内层循环
case switch语句中选择项
char单字节整型数据
const定义不可更改的常量值
continue中断本次循环,并转向下一次循环
default switch语句中的默认选择项do 用于构成do。。。。。while循环语句
double定义双精度浮点型数据
else构成if。。。。。else选择程序结构
enum枚举extern在其它程序模块中说明了全局变量
float定义单精度浮点型数据
for构成for循环语句
goto构成goto转移结构
if构成if。。。。else选择结构
int基本整型数据
long长整型数据
registerCPU内部寄存的变量
return用于返回函数的返回值
short短整型数据
signed有符号数
sizoef计算表达式或数据类型的占用字节数
static定义静态变量
struct定义结构类型数据
switch构成switch选择结构
typedef重新定义数据类型
union联合类型数据
unsigned定义无符号数据
void定义无类型数据
volatile该变量在程序中执行中可被隐含地改变
while用于构成do。。。while或while循环结构
然后你在记住9种控制结构就OK。
goto语句:无条件转向;if语句:判断语句;while循环语句; do-while语句:先执行循环体,然后判断循环条件是否成立, 之后继续循环;for语句:循环,可替代while语句,只是用法不同;break语句跳出本层的循环;(只调处包含此语句的循环)continue语句:继续(一般放到循环语句里,不在执行它下面的语句,直接跳到判断语句例:for语句,就直接跳到第二个分号处,while语句,就直接跳到while()的括号里; switch语句:多相选择; return语句:返回;
就这样了,这就是对掌握C语言的的基本知识要求,这仅仅是入门到要可以写出程序还远着呢。
本文内容转载自网络,本着分享与传播的原则,版权归原作者所有,如有侵权请联系我们进行删除。
填写下面表单即可预约申请免费试听!怕钱不够?可就业挣钱后再付学费! 怕学不会?助教全程陪读,随时解惑!担心就业?一地学习,可全国推荐就业!
Copyright © 京ICP备08000853号-56 京公网安备 11010802029508号 达内时代科技集团有限公司 版权所有
Tedu.cn All Rights Reserved